Commercial Registration Renewal

Renewing the commercial registration is a periodic procedure that keeps the registration entry and the activity valid with the Ministry of Industry and Commerce. The application to renew the entry and the activity is submitted six months before expiry, and membership of the Bahrain Chamber of Commerce and Industry is renewed three months before. Late renewal results in the registration being suspended and every transaction linked to it being blocked.

The effect of late renewal

Suspension of the registration

Late renewal results in the registration being suspended and every transaction linked to it being blocked.

An effect on work permits

Suspension of the registration carries over to transactions with the Labour Market Regulatory Authority, and may put existing work permits at risk.

Higher cost

The cost and the time of dealing with a suspended registration exceed what renewal on time requires.

A limited recovery window

Reactivation remains possible for up to three years from the date of suspension, after which the registration is lost for good.
